Guide to Using Meezan Banks SWIFT Code for Global Transfers
The SWIFT/BIC code for international remittances at MEEZAN BANK LIMITED is MEZNPKKAGRW, located in GUJRANWALA. Using this code ensures the smooth processing of international wire transfers.
